Bathsheba reminds us that God does not define us by the chapter others try to write about us. From a place of vulnerability, she became the mother of Solomon and a key voice in securing God’s promised future. Her presence in Jesus’ lineage declares that redemption doesn’t erase the past—it redeems it.
